Please note that only bare metal[1,2] EC2 instances provide direct access to cpu of the underlying server and its' features like Intel VT-x required to run your own hypervisor. You can - on bare metal EC2 instances. Storage virtualization uses all your physical data storage and creates a large unit of virtual storage that you can assign and control by using management software. Application virtualization pulls out the functions of applications to run on operating systems other than the operating systems for which they were designed.
